President arrives on 2-day visit to JK;Received by Governor, CM

JAMMU, APRIL 18: President Ram Nath Kovind, accompanied by First Lady Savita Kovind today arrived here on 2-day visit to the winter capital of the state.

Governor N N Vohra, Chief Minister Mehbooba Mufti, Speaker Legislative Assembly Kavinder Gupta, Chairman Legislative Council Haji Anayat Ali, Deputy Chief Minister, Dr Nirmal Singh, Minister for Revenue Abdul Rehman Veeri, Minister for Cooperatives Chering Dorjay, Minister for PHE Sham Lal Choudhary and Minister for Food Civil Supplies & Consumer Affairs Zulfkar Ali received the President at the Technical Airport here.

Chief Secretary B B Vyas, Director General of Police Dr S P Vaid, Divisional Commissioner Jammu Hemant Kumar Sharma and military and paramilitary officials were also present on the occasion.

The President is visiting the state to address the sixth Convocation of Shr Mata Vaishno Devi University (SMVDU) at Katra today.

Over 880 scholars will receive their degrees and merit certificates at the ceremony. Founder & Chairman of Bharti Enterprises, Sunil Bharti Mittal and Chairman-cum-Managing Director, Munjal Auto Engineering Ltd, Sudhir Munjal will be conferred honorary Doctorate by SMVDU on the occasion.

A civic reception will be held at Amar Mahal Lawns in Jammu city to honor Kovind later in the day.

He will be also meeting the Chief Justice, Justice Ramalingam Sudhakar and other Judges of the Jammu and Kashmir High Court over breakfast here.
